So far, no one has identified any major errors that were the results of faulty measurement.

Two common misconceptions are actually errors of a different sort -- the Mars Climate Orbiter and the Hubble Space Telescope. The Mars Climate Orbiter was lost due to an inadequately documented computer program. The program produced estimated total thruster impulse. The results were thought to be in Newtons but actually were in pounds-force. This led do incorrect trajectory estimates. The trajectory was thought to be safely above the planet for Mars orbit insertion, but it was much lower. The spacecraft flew through the atmosphere during orbit insertion, causing the spacecraft to be destroyed by aeroheating.

A lesson that could have been learned there was that the English system of measurements must be expunged from the face of the earth (and the rest of the solar system). But it wasn't. NASA still uses a mish-mashes of mixed units. However, there are much bigger lessons to be learned here that apply to all walks of life.

* Communication between team members is essential. * Don't assume you know something -- verify * Have all interfaces documented and agreed to by all team members * A simulation of the pieces does not equal the whole * A test of the pieces does not equal the whole * Expect the unexpected and have recovery options

Hubble's problems were due to an incorrectly assembled optical instrument that was used to grind the mirror. Then the same instrument was used to verify that the mirror had been correctly ground.
